Best Paper To Print Brochures On - If you’re wondering about the best type of paper for brochures, the easy answer is that most brochures will look and feel good when they’re printed on 100 lb silk text. You'll learn everything you need to know. This weight offers a light feel, proper readability, and optimal picture quality. Which brochure paper option should you choose?
